The Six Ways Spreadsheets Fail Zumba Studios

1. Package Balances Go Wrong

A member buys a 20-class pack. They attend a class. Someone forgets to deduct it from the spreadsheet. They attend three more classes. Someone deducts two instead of three. By month-end, the spreadsheet says 15 classes remaining. The actual balance is 16. Or 14. Nobody knows for certain. Multiply this across 150 members with different package types, and the error rate becomes operationally significant.

2. Expirations Get Missed

A member’s 10-class pack expires in 90 days. Nobody sets a reminder. The member uses 7 classes and the pack quietly expires. Three classes lost. The member is upset. The studio either honors the expired classes (losing revenue) or enforces the expiration (losing goodwill). Both outcomes are bad, and both were preventable with automatic expiration tracking.

3. Payment Reconciliation Is a Weekend Project

Members pay through bKash and send screenshots to WhatsApp. Someone enters the payment in the spreadsheet. Some payments get entered. Some get missed. Some get entered with the wrong amount. Reconciling bKash transactions against the spreadsheet takes 3 to 6 hours per week at a 150-member studio.

4. Instructor Pay Gets Disputed

Instructor pay depends on how many classes they taught and how many students attended. The spreadsheet tracks this, but the numbers depend on someone manually entering attendance after every class. When instructor pay does not match the instructor’s own count, disputes follow.

5. No Member Visibility

Members cannot see their own package balance, payment history, or upcoming bookings. They ask the studio owner, who checks the spreadsheet, which may or may not be current. Every inquiry takes 2 to 5 minutes of the owner’s time.

6. The Spreadsheet Does Not Scale

At 50 members, spreadsheet management is manageable. At 100, it is fragile. At 200, it has failed. The studio owner either hires someone specifically to manage the spreadsheets (expensive) or accepts the errors (costly). Neither option is sustainable.

The Migration Path: Spreadsheet to Software in 2 Weeks

Replacing spreadsheets does not require a month of downtime. Here is the realistic path for a Bangladeshi Zumba studio.

Week 1: Clean and Import

Export your current member spreadsheet. Clean the data: remove duplicates, verify phone numbers, confirm package balances as accurately as possible. Import into Fitssort. Set up class schedule, instructors, and package types. This takes 2 to 3 days of active work.

Week 2: Parallel Run and Cutover

Run the new system alongside the spreadsheet for one week. Verify that bookings, attendance, and payments match. Fix any discrepancies. Then retire the spreadsheet and run fully on the platform. Train staff. Onboard members to the mobile app.

Week 3 and Beyond: Automation Layers

Add automated package expiration alerts, renewal reminders, no-show policies, and instructor pay reports. Each automation removes a manual task that previously consumed time.

Why This Matters Specifically for Bangladeshi Zumba Studios

bKash Reconciliation Is the Biggest Pain Point

In markets where members pay by credit card, payment reconciliation is relatively automated already. In Bangladesh, where bKash screenshots are the payment infrastructure, reconciliation is the single largest administrative burden. Automating this one process saves 3 to 6 hours per week and is often the reason that justifies the entire software switch.

Zumba Package Complexity

Zumba studios sell multiple package types simultaneously: 10-class packs, 20-class packs, unlimited monthly, introductory offers, event tickets. Tracking balances and expirations across all of these in a spreadsheet is error-prone by design. Software handles it natively.

Instructor Pay Is a Recurring Friction

Most Bangladeshi Zumba studios work with multiple instructors, each with different pay arrangements. Monthly pay calculation from spreadsheet data is one of the most common sources of disputes. Automatic calculation from actual attendance data eliminates this.
